TC4468CPD Overview
The package or case for this particular electronic component is a 14-DIP (0.300, 7.62mm) size, which is a standard size for integrated circuits. It is classified under the JESD-609 Code as e3, indicating its compliance with industry standards. This component is currently active and available for use, as indicated by its Part Status. Its ECCN Code is EAR99, meaning it is not subject to any export control restrictions. The maximum power dissipation for this component is 800mW, making it suitable for a variety of applications. It has 4 functions and can handle an output current of 1.2A. The rise time for this component is 25ns and the turn on time is 0.1 μs, making it a fast and efficient option. Additionally, it features a high side driver, providing even more versatility and functionality for users. Overall, this component is a reliable and high-performing choice for electronic projects.
